Social media is no longer just a tool for communication; it has become a primary source of entertainment. Platforms like TikTok and Instagram have blurred the lines between creator and consumer. Short-form video content, viral challenges, and influencer-led storytelling now compete directly with big-budget Hollywood productions for the public's attention. This shift has democratized media production, allowing anyone with a smartphone to contribute to the global zeitgeist. Gone are the days when audiences were tethered to scheduled television broadcasts or specific cinema showtimes. The rise of streaming platforms has revolutionized how we consume content. Today, entertainment content and popular media are defined by accessibility. This on-demand culture allows users to curate their own media experiences, leading to the fragmentation of the traditional "mass audience" into specialized niche communities. Modern popular media is a global conversation. A series produced in South Korea can become a worldwide sensation overnight, while a musician from South Africa can top the charts in Europe and North America. This cross-cultural exchange enriches the entertainment landscape, providing audiences with a wider variety of perspectives and storytelling styles than ever before.
Innovation continues to push the boundaries of entertainment. Vir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) are offering more immersive ways to engage with stories and games. Furthermore, artificial intelligence is beginning to play a role in content creation, from personalizing recommendation algorithms to assisting in the production of music and visual effects.
